Recent sale sets a high floor | Low rental yield limits investor appeal | Subdivision potential adds strategic optionality | Long holding period signals deep family roots in street
The sale price signals buyer confidence in this pocket of Capalaba, but the rental yield of approximately 3.36 percent constrains upside for investors seeking income coverage. The 804sqm lot with no flood or bushfire overlay offers genuine subdivision optionality, which a buyer can execute subject to council approval โ this is the core financial lever. If holding for capital growth while renting, expect the yield to underwrite a modest carry cost; for an owner-occupier with a renovation appetite, the recently updated kitchen and patio create immediate livability without overspend. This property should be treated as a long-term hold with an eye on future lot release.
The lack of recent street sales and an 85 percent owner-occupier profile indicate low turnover and entrenched community fabric โ a competitive advantage for a buyer seeking stable, low-risk suburban exposure. The 14 percent building coverage leaves considerable land underused, and side access to a shed strengthens utility for trades or storage. Best suited to a family or a buyer with a three-to-five-year horizon who will occupy the house while evaluating subdivision feasibility.
The absence of comparable street sales makes this a pricing outlier in the immediate locale; a buyer should verify the sale date and current market pulse before committing.

Market Insight:
Capalaba is a high-owner-occupancy suburb driven by young families, evidenced by its dominant 30-39 age demographic. This demand has fuelled robust annual house price growth of 8.8%-13.14%, with houses selling in a brisk 26 days. Future growth is supported by strong population increases and rental demand, though the market shows sensitivity to interest rates amid high price points and variable sales volumes.
